Coding Compliance Specialist

  • University Hospitals Health System
  • Cleveland, Ohio
  • Full Time

DescriptionA Brief OverviewThe Coding Compliance Specialist performs documentation and coding audits based on multiple failed reviews as performed by the Clinical Documentation Improvement Specialists within the organization under oversight of the Supervisor of Coding Compliance to mitigate risk and ensure providers are coding and documenting in alignment with governmental standards.What You Will DoAssists in reviewing of internal data reports to identify areas of coding and documentation risk that need to be audited and reviewed to ensure the organization aligns with governmental billing, coding, and documentation standards.Plans and conducts routine compliance audit reviews including chart audits to evaluate the accuracy of medical codes assigned to patient services documented in a medical record.Performs auditing and monitoring of assigned coding and documentation related materials to ensure materials comply with governmental with applicable laws, regulations, and contractual obligations.Assists in the research and development of compliance tools and resources for internal use and publication by employees or team membersServe as a team member and assist on UH initiatives, as needed.Participates in meetings with and presentations to employees, providers, medical staff, and management as needed.Participates the annual risk assessment process in order to identify risks and potential audits for inclusion in the annual work plan.Works with department leadership to identify and implement improvements to Compliance & Ethics Department processesPrepares clear, concise, and accurate documentation and records in a timely manner and according to departmental guidelines.Prepares written findings and recommendations in a logical, clear, and concise manner.Creates and delivers coding and documentation education to prevent, mitigate, and remediate risk.Additional ResponsibilitiesPerforms other duties as assigned.Complies with all policies and standards.For specific duties and responsibilities, refer to documentation provided by the department during orientation.Must abide by all requirements to safely and securely maintain Protected Health Information (PHI) for our patients.
